Answer:
0, 2 . . . . . (any pair of consecutive even integers)
Step-by-step explanation:
You want a pair of consecutive even integers such that twice the lesser is 4 less than two times the greater.
<h3>Setup</h3>
Let x represent the lesser of the two even integers. Then the greater is (x+2) and the given relation is ...
2x = 2(x+2) -4
<h3>Solution</h3>
Simplifying gives ...
2x = 2x +4 -4
2x = 2x . . . . . . . true for any even integer x
Any pair of consecutive even integers will satisfy the relation.
one such pair is 0, 2
<em>check</em>: 2(2) -4 = 2(0)
